GOP Governors Back Trump's Pledge to Shield Consumers from Data-Center Costs

Trump announced that 23 Republican governors have signed his Ratepayer Protection Pledge to prevent households from bearing data-center energy costs as AI infrastructure expands, expanding a coalition that includes major tech companies; the pledge is non-binding but asks governors to implement its principles, while Democrats have not signed and three Republican governors have not joined.

Ex‑military leaders urge governors to limit National Guard use for America 250 celebration

A group of retired national security leaders sent letters to Democratic governors praising their decision not to deploy National Guard troops for the America 250th celebration, arguing such deployments would undermine force morale, readiness, and civil-military norms. The issue highlights broader partisan tensions over Guard use, with Michigan threatening to pull its support if Guard involvement extends beyond the anniversary, while the White House defends the celebration and counters the criticisms.

First Lady Unveils Groundbreaking Savings Vehicle for Foster Youth

First Lady Melania Trump announced the Fostering the Future Accounts, the United States’ first dedicated savings and investment vehicle for foster youth, aimed at asset ownership and long-term wealth building when they reach adulthood. Treasury guidance now allows state child welfare agencies to open accounts for children in foster care, with 23 governors pledging to participate and calls for nationwide funding from leaders and businesses to support all 50 states, under the One Big Beautiful Bill Act.

Data centers push Trump and Democrats toward common ground on energy costs

With voters blaming rising electricity bills on data centers, Democratic governors are rolling back tax incentives and pursuing new power-generation rules, while Trump has begun pushing tech giants to build their own power plants to shield ratepayers—marking a rare bipartisan pivot as regulators and lawmakers seek to balance jobs with affordable energy and curb AI infrastructure costs.

Trump hosts governors' breakfast as NGA withdraws from White House gathering

President Donald Trump hosts a White House governors’ breakfast after the National Governors Association pulls out of its annual meeting over his exclusion of two Democratic governors, Jared Polis of Colorado and Wes Moore of Maryland. The move highlights ongoing partisan tensions even as governors from both parties meet to discuss policy, and underscores Trump’s confrontational approach toward state leaders while some governors push for limited presidential power and bipartisan dialogue. The event set against potential 2028 presidential considerations among governors.

Blue-state governors rush to blunt Trump's deportation drive with legal barriers

Democratic governors in states like Massachusetts, New York, New Jersey and Illinois are moving to curb federal immigration enforcement by banning or limiting local cooperation with ICE, creating oversight measures, and pursuing restrictions on civil deportations in sensitive locations, in response to violence concerns and shifting public opinion about Trump’s deportation agenda.

Democratic Governors Unite to Counter Potential Trump Policies

Democratic Governors J.B. Pritzker of Illinois and Jared Polis of Colorado have announced a new coalition, Governors Safeguarding Democracy (GSD), aimed at protecting state-level democratic institutions in response to Donald Trump's presidency. The non-partisan group, supported by GovAct and advised by a bipartisan board, will focus on safeguarding the rule of law and key state institutions. The initiative, funded by philanthropic sources, seeks to collaborate across state lines and leverage governors' powers to address emerging threats to democracy. The coalition is modeled after the Reproductive Freedom Alliance and aims to include governors from both parties.

Record Number of Women Governors as Ayotte Wins New Hampshire

A record 13 women will serve as state governors in the U.S. next year, following Republican Kelly Ayotte's victory in New Hampshire. This surpasses the previous record of 12 set in 2022. The increase in female governors highlights progress in gender representation, though experts note more work is needed. Women governors often influence policies on caregiving and women's issues, and their presence can inspire future generations. Despite these gains, 18 states have never elected a female governor.
